AI‑Powered Safety: Protecting Guests While Cutting Costs

Predictive Maintenance for Trampoline Surfaces

Every jump creates wear on the trampoline surface and frames. In Wellington’s damp climate, wear can accelerate, leading to safety hazards if not addressed promptly. An AI expert can set up a sensor network that captures vibration, tension, and temperature data from each trampoline zone.

Using machine learning models, the system predicts when a section is likely to fail—often days before a visible defect appears. The park then schedules maintenance proactively, avoiding costly downtime and potential liability claims.

Cost savings example: JumpStart Wellington installed vibration sensors on 20 trampolines. Over a six‑month pilot, predictive maintenance reduced unscheduled repairs by 40% and saved NZ$12,000 in labor costs.

Automated Video Surveillance with Real‑Time Alerts

AI‑driven video analytics can detect risky behavior—such as multiple jumpers colliding or a child attempting a prohibited trick. The system flags the incident to staff via a mobile app, allowing immediate intervention.

AI‑Driven Sales: Turning Data Into Dollars

Dynamic Pricing Based on Demand Forecasting

Traditional pricing for trampoline parks is static: a flat rate per hour or a season pass price that rarely changes. AI changes this by analyzing:

  • Historical attendance patterns (day of week, school holidays, weather)
  • Competitor promotions in the Wellington region
  • Real‑time booking trends

The result is a dynamic pricing engine that adjusts rates by up to 15% during peak demand and offers discounts during off‑peak slots, nudging visitors to fill otherwise empty time blocks.

Practical Tips for Wellington Park Owners to Start Their AI Journey

1. Conduct a Quick AI Readiness Audit

Identify three core pain points—safety, staffing, or sales—and map the data you already collect (e.g., visitor logs, maintenance records). Knowing what data you have will guide the AI tools you need.

2. Start Small with One Pilot Project

Choose a low‑risk AI use case that offers quick ROI:

  • Predictive maintenance on a single trampoline zone
  • Chatbot for weekend booking inquiries
  • Dynamic pricing for a specific hourly slot

Measure results against a baseline, then scale the solution across the whole venue.

3. Leverage Existing Cloud Platforms

Many AI services (Google Cloud AI, Microsoft Azure Cognitive Services, AWS SageMaker) offer pre‑built models for video analytics, forecasting, and chatbot development. Using these reduces the need for a large in‑house data science team.

4. Partner with an Experienced AI Consultant

Implementing AI isn’t just about technology—it's about aligning solutions with business goals. An AI consultant can help you:

  • Define measurable KPIs (e.g., reduction in injuries, increase in revenue per hour)
  • Select the right tools and ensure data privacy compliance under New Zealand law
  • Train staff on interpreting AI insights and taking action

5. Monitor, Iterate, and Communicate Results

Set up a dashboard that tracks safety incidents, maintenance costs, occupancy rates, and sales conversions. Share wins with your team to build confidence and keep momentum.
